Bharti Airtel is trading -0.34% lower at Rs 2,096.40 as compared to its last closing price. Bharti Airtel has been trading in the price range of 2,104.50 & 2,091.25. Bharti Airtel has given 32.50% in this year & -0.56% in the last 5 days. Bharti Airtel has TTM P/E ratio 28.23 as compared to the sector P/E of 17.90.There are 30 analysts who have initiated coverage on Bharti Airtel. There are 11 analysts who have given it a strong buy rating & 13 analysts have given it a buy rating. 4 analysts have given the stock a sell rating.The company posted a net profit of 6,791.70 Crores in its last quarter.Listed peers of Bharti Airtel include Bharti Airtel (-0.34%), Bharti Hexacom (-0.42%), Vodafone Idea (0.66%).The Mutual Fund holding in Bharti Airtel was at 11.32% in 30 Sep 2025. The MF holding has increased from the last quarter. The FII holding in Bharti Airtel was at 27.42% in 30 Sep 2025. The FII holding has increased from the last quarter.

About the company Bharti Airtel
  • IndustryCommunications Services
  • ISININE397D01024
  • BSE Code532454
  • NSE CodeBHARTIARTL
Bharti Airtel Limited is a telecommunication company. It operates through two business divisions: India & South Asia and Africa. Its B2C Services consists of Mobile Services (India), Homes Services, and Digital TV Services. Its B2B Services consists of Airtel Business and South Asia. Its Mobile Services (India) segment offers postpaid, pre-paid, roaming, Internet and other value-added services. Its Homes Services segment provides fixed-line telephone and broadband services for homes in approximately 1,290 cities. Its Digital TV Services provides direct-to-home (DTH) platform, which offers a total of 725 channels including 94 HD channels, 64 SVOD services, four international channels and four interactive services. Its Airtel Business segment offers fixed-line voice (PRIs), data and other connectivity solutions, such as Multi-Protocol Label Switching (MPLS),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P), SIP trucking. Its South Asia segment represents its operation in Bangladesh.
